60-Day Notice to Terminate Tenants
Effective July 8, 2008, a tenant or subtenant in possession of a rental housing unit that has been sold through foreclosure is generally entitled to a 60-day written notice to quit, not just 30 days. However, a borrower who remains on the property after foreclosure may be served a three-day [...]

Effective July 8, 2008, anyone who acquires property through foreclosure must maintain the exterior of vacant residential property. Violations of this law include permitting excessive foliage growth that diminishes the value of surrounding properties, failing to take action against trespassers or squatters, failing to take action to prevent mosquitoes from breeding in standing water, or other public nuisances.
